BUSINESS NEWS
- ➤ Benavides Driving School celebrated 50 years in service in the Rio Grande Valley after being started in 1975 by the late Pedro 'Pete' Benavides in Brownsville—now it operates in Brownsville, Harlingen, and McAllen with 15 vehicles and over 30 employees. The family-owned school offers safe driving lessons with modern vehicles and bilingual classes and will grow further through local partnerships. Rio Grande Guardian
EDUCATION NEWS
- ➤ The Institute for Leadership in Capital Projects recently hosted a forum —Classroom to Commerce: The Economic Power of Education in the Rio Grande Valley— at the Embassy Suites by Hilton McAllen Convention Center. Panelists Daniel P. King, Ron Garza and Paul Rodriguez shared their views on how education drives local economic growth as led by ERO Architects CEO Brian Godinez. Rio Grande Guardian
- ➤ At a forum at Embassy Suites, Eloy Garza of Career Bridge and UTRGV urged area employers to give students hands-on work experience—an effort that builds real-world skills and career pathways. He explained that connecting students with local businesses through programs like RGV Lead will expand career and internship opportunities. Rio Grande Guardian
G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 State Sen. Juan Hinojosa said he is proud of his work in the 89th Legislature where he helped pass 31 measures and coauthored 111 bills that aim to boost school funding, water infrastructure, and property tax relief in our region. He secured millions in funding for projects that will improve public safety, flood control, and economic growth—steps that will help local communities advance. Rio Grande Guardian
